Norman Todd Bates

In the early morning of August 27, 2015, N. Todd Bates, surrounded by his loving and caring family, left the hunting grounds on earth, when he finally lost his courageous and amazing fight with cancer, to follow the trails and tracks into heaven. He was born on October 31, 1971. His parents are "Mom" Sharon and David Burland and "Dad" Norman C. Bates. He was raised in Utah and graduated in 1990 from Woods Cross High School. He also attended classes at Weber State University. N Todd Bates had an array of jobs from washing UPS trucks, building houses, and driving many different kinds of trucks. He excelled at whatever it was he was doing. However, in January of 2004 he found his career with the Big West Oil Company, where he had become an Operator. His passions included, first and foremost, his amazing wife Amy of 11 years, to whom he wed in May 2004, and their handsome blessing, their son, Grady Todd, born January 2013. However his second passion was the outdoors, whether it be fishing of any kind, to hunting big game preferably a bow in his hand. N Todd Bates was an extraordinary man. He was a husband, daddy, son, brother, uncle, nephew, cousin, son-in-law, brother-in-law, and friend. Everyone that had the great opportunity to meet Todd and know him, are truly blessed. He was deeply loved and cared for by all that knew him. We are all better human beings for having someone such as him in our lives. He is survived by his loving wife, Amy; son, Grady Todd; parents: "Mom" Sharon and David Burland and "Dad" Norman C. Bates; sisters: Shauna (Jason) Feil, Amanda (Brian) Farrell, and Carlie (Bryan) Boyce; nieces and nephews; aunts and uncles; Mother-, Father-, sister-, and brothers-in-law; and many cousins. He was preceded in death by his Grandpa and Grandma Hammer, and Grandpa and Grandma Bates.
